Doxepin is an important antidepressant drug useful in the treatment of mild to moderate endogenous depression. The synthesis of doxepin involves acid catalysis leading to the formation of E- and Z- isomers. So herein, we report the use and effect of various acid catalysts on the formation E- and Z- isomers. Characterization of both the isomers was achieved by using HPLC and NMR. Both NMR and HPLC analysis showed that E-isomer as the major component.
